Anyone know the size of the oil filter on the c900 and the diameter of
the upper water hose?

I am trying to add oil pressure, oil temp and water sensors to my '86
900T and this company (links at end of post) makes some really cool,
"painless" adapters that allow quick hook up of standard send units
without major work. I need the size of the items so i can get the proper
piece.

I'm not sure how to specify the filter size. 8-) But I do know that the
casing of the standard oil filter that Saab used until recently (the
blue one) is 74 mm diameter with 15 flats. If you have a spare oil
filter you could take it to a mechanic's workshop and use their tools
to work out the thread diameter.

The exact same oil filter is used from the Saab 99's right through to
most (but not all) of the post-GM-takeover models including the 9-5's.
How's that for a versatile part! The old-style blue filters are Saab #
9144445. I don't know what the part number for the new black-coloured
one is.

There are some places on Ebay selling sender adaptors too which I think
are just like the ones you included links for.

GM # 93186554 on the box and FGP55560202 on the filter

A quick digging in my garage results in FRAM PH5550 or MANN W712/38 as
possible filters, the latter being a bit shorter.
